Has any one the BBC's latest Saturday Night Gameshow, 'Here comes the Sun'?
Hosted by Claire Sweeney, two families consisting of five people (no children) go head to head in the hope of winning a luxery Apartment in Spain where they can stay for two weeks a year for the rest of their lives.
They do challenges testing how well they can work together.
The final is a memory test where you look around the Apartment for 5 minutes, memorising it. You are then asked questions about what was where in the Apartment.. When they get a question right they can choose a key and if it opens the door they win!
PS However many games are lost by each family, that is how many people are lost to play in the Final
